#54a1c1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54a1c1 is composed of 32.9% red, 63.1%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.5% cyan, 16.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 197.6 degrees, a saturation of 46.8% and a lightness of 54.3%. #54a1c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#004383.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#54a1c1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#54a1c1 has RGB values of R:84, G:161,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 5546433.
